Give an account of the Hershey and Chase experiment. What did it conclusively prove? If both $DNA$ and proteins contained phosphorus and sulphur,do you think the result would have been the same?

(N/A) The unequivocal proof that $DNA$ is the genetic material came from the experiments of Alfred Hershey and Martha Chase $(1952)$. They worked with viruses that infect bacteria,called bacteriophages.
$1$. Experimental Setup: They grew some viruses on a medium containing radioactive phosphorus $(^{32}P)$ and others on a medium containing radioactive sulfur $(^{35}S)$. Since $DNA$ contains phosphorus but not sulfur,viruses grown in radioactive phosphorus had radioactive $DNA$. Conversely,since proteins contain sulfur but not phosphorus,viruses grown in radioactive sulfur had radioactive proteins.
$2$. Infection and Blending: These radioactive phages were allowed to infect $E. coli$ bacteria. After infection,the viral coats were removed from the bacterial surface by agitating them in a blender.
$3$. Centrifugation: The virus particles were separated from the bacteria by spinning them in a centrifuge. The heavier bacterial cells formed a pellet,while the lighter viral coats remained in the supernatant.
$4$. Conclusion: Bacteria infected with viruses containing radioactive $DNA$ $(^{32}P)$ were found to be radioactive,whereas bacteria infected with viruses containing radioactive proteins $(^{35}S)$ were not. This conclusively proved that $DNA$,not protein,is the genetic material that enters the bacteria.
$5$. Hypothetical Scenario: If both $DNA$ and proteins contained both phosphorus and sulfur,the experiment would not have been able to distinguish between the two. The radioactivity would have been present in both the pellet and the supernatant regardless of which molecule entered the cell,making it impossible to conclude which one was the genetic material.
